Леннарт Поттеринг представил mkosi, инструмент для генерации образов ОС
Следом за casync, Леннарт Поттеринг представил ещё один свой проект — mkosi (Make Operating System Image).
mkosi предназначен для генерации загрузочных образов операционных систем, представляющий собой обёртку над утилитами dnf --installroot, debootstrap, pacstrap и zypper.
Поддерживается создание образов на базе дистрибутивов Fedora, Debian, Ubuntu, Arch Linux, openSUSE. Созданный образ можно запустить из контейнера командой «systemd-nspawn -b -i image.raw».
mkosi позиционируется как legacy-free, т. е. программа поддерживает только актуальные на сегодняшний день технологии. Это означает поддержку только таблиц разделов GPT (и отсутсвие поддержки MBR), возможность генерации образов, основанных только на systemd, и генерацию только для загрузки на системах с поддержкой EFI (не MBR/BIOS).
Проект написан на языке python, распространяется под лицензией LGPL-2.1.
Репозиторий на github — https://github.com/systemd/mkosi.
>>> Подробности